Understanding the Rolex Submariner Market:
The Rolex Submariner's price isn't simply a fixed number; it's a dynamic figure influenced by numerous variables. These factors contribute to the wide range of prices you'll encounter when researching the watch, making a comprehensive understanding crucial for informed decision-making.
1. Model and Year: The Submariner has undergone several iterations throughout its history, each with its own unique features and collector appeal. Early models, particularly vintage pieces, command significantly higher prices due to their rarity and historical significance. Later models, while still highly sought after, generally fall into a different price bracket. Specific model variations, such as the no-date Submariner versus the date version, also influence price. The year of manufacture plays a critical role; a 1950s Submariner will fetch a far higher price than a 2020 model, all other factors being equal.
2. Condition: The condition of the watch is paramount. A pristine, unblemished Submariner in its original box and papers will command a premium price. Conversely, a watch showing significant wear and tear, even with necessary servicing, will be valued considerably lower. Scratches, dents, and imperfections all impact the overall value. The integrity of the bracelet is also crucial; original bracelets in excellent condition are highly desirable.
3. Box and Papers: The presence of the original box and papers (warranty card, instruction booklet, etc.) significantly increases the value of a pre-owned Submariner. These documents authenticate the watch's legitimacy and provenance, adding a layer of confidence for buyers. A complete set dramatically influences the final price.
4. Market Demand: Like any luxury item, the demand for the Rolex Submariner fluctuates. Certain models or years become particularly sought after, leading to increased prices. Limited edition pieces or those with unique features command even higher values due to their rarity. Current market trends and economic conditions also play a role.
5. Location and Retailer: The price of a Rolex Submariner can also vary based on the location of purchase and the retailer. Authorized dealers will generally charge higher prices than pre-owned watch retailers or private sellers. Geographic location can also affect pricing due to variations in local taxes, import duties, and market demand.
